File-In this April 21, 2009 file photo, Minneapolis Star Tribune columnist Sid Hartman is shown in St. Paul, Minn. The Minnesota sports columnist and radio personality, Hartman, an old-school home team booster who once ran the NBA’s Minneapolis Lakers and achieved nearly as much celebrity as some of the athletes he covered, died Sunday, Oct. 18, 2020. He was 100. (AP Photo/Jim Mone, File)(AP Photo/Jim Mone, File)
Longtime Minnesota sports columnist Sid Hartman dies at 100
